Estate Planning with LSD?
No, this article has nothing
to do with Timothy Leary. The LSD of the estate planning community is the
"lump sum distribution," which can sometimes produce significant tax benefits
for individuals who have participated in a certain type of company retirement
plan and can afford to give those assets away.

Research Points to Protein as Alzheimer's
Culprit
Researchers at the National
Institute of Environmental Health Sciences have discovered that a protein
found in patients with Alzheimer’s disease can disrupt brain signals and
therefore may contribute to the memory losses of Alzheimer’s disease.

Tax Court Throws Out §25.2702-3(e),
Example 5
The Tax Court recently held
that a grantor's retained interests in two grantor retained annuity trusts
(GRATs) with two-year terms should be valued as annuities for a specified
term of years and not as annuities for the shorter of a term certain or
the period ending upon the grantor's death. |

HHS Will Not Implement Prescription Drug Law
Health and Human Services
Secretary Donna Shalala is refusing to implement a law aimed at cutting
prescription drug prices by allowing the drugs to be reimported from Canada.
In a letter to President Clinton, Shalala cited "serious flaws and loopholes"
that "make it impossible . . . to demonstrate that [the law] is safe and
cost effective."

Pay Income Taxes Online at Officialpayments.com
As of January 12, 2001, the
IRS will begin accepting online payments for Form 1040 income taxes, Form
1040ES Estimated Payments, and Form 4868 extensions of time to file tax
returns. |
